Responsibilities
Understand data and deliver holistic insights utilising operational
data such as: AHT;
pitch-rates and action-rates (revenue); Understand how to map these
signals to Voice of
the Customer data and Quality Assurance data to identify, through
root-cause analysis,
the agent behavioural levers driving operational performance across
multiple programs,
regions markets and verticals. Leverage and unify multiple customer
listening posts
(surveys, customer verbatim, focus groups, social media, etc.) to
create a more reliable
and sensitive customer feedback signal. Develop and assess customer
experience
through direct contact interactions and trend analysis, ensuring
strong reporting
capability on contact centre agent performance, understanding and
communicating the
narrative to internal and external stakeholders through a robust
set of metrics, data
visualization and presentation. Coordinate with outsourced vendor
partners (as
required) to share insights, identify focus areas, and agree on
actions. Create specific
recommendations and action plans to drive product, people and
process improvement
strategy across multiple customer touchpoints and work with
cross-functional partners
to identify and implement optimal solutions.
